COVID-19 service update: Tighter restrictions in effect from 31st July.

Opening times at all five sites of the Reykjavík City Museum will remain unchanged. There will be no guided tours while the 2-meter rule is in effect. Scheduled events during this period may also be affected. The museum will ensure that hand sanitizer is available for visitors and staff in and around all high-touch areas: by entrances, reception desks and where interactive screens and devices are located. Enhanced routine cleaning regimes will be implemented with signage and clear markings emphasizing personal hygiene measures and individual responsibility. The museum also ensures that the assembly limit of no more than 100 people is respected.

Óðinn Coast Guard Vessel under repair

The former Coast Guard Vessel Óðinn was pulled into the shipyard of Reykjavík’s old harbour this morning 15th October to undergo some maintenance and repairs. Óðinn is famous for its role in all three Cod Wars but today the vessel serves as a floating exhibit at Reykjavík’s Maritime Museum.
